    Hi! I have a MYW package booked thru Delta Vacations for 1 adult and 1 4yr old. Would I be able to add one more day to PH when I check in even tho I booked with Delta? If yes, will I only have to pay the $21 difference between 5day PH and 6day PH?

    Hi Trinity!
     
    Congratulations on booking your Walt Disney World vacation!  You and your family will enjoy many of the attractions and entertainment available at the Disney parks and resorts, including the newest additions to Fantasyland and Hollywood Studios!
     
    As you've booked your vacation via a third party vendor, Delta, in this case, upgrading prior to arrival would need to be done via Delta.  If, after you've arrived at the resort you wish to upgrade your tickets, you would be able to head to the Guest Services window and add a day to your tickets.  Keep in mind that pricing changes may occur by the time you wish to upgrade, so you may be responsible for additional charges.
